A garage door opener is a device used to open and close a garage door. It is an essential component of modern homes that have an attached garage. Garage door openers operate on electrical power and come with a remote control that allows the user to open and close the garage door from a distance.

Convenience:

A garage door opener is a convenient device that allows the homeowner to open and close the garage door without having to physically lift or lower it. However, the convenience of a garage door opener is greatly reduced during a power outage. This is where a backup battery for your garage door opener comes in handy.

Garage door opener functionality during power outages

A backup battery ensures that the garage door opener continues to function during power outages, allowing the homeowner to access the garage and leave the house without any inconvenience. This is especially important in emergency situations where the garage may serve as an exit route.

No need to manually open or close the garage door

Without a backup battery, homeowners may need to manually open or close the garage door during a power outage, which can be challenging and time-consuming, especially for those who have physical limitations.

Installation process:

Installing a backup battery for your garage door opener is a simple process that can be done by homeowners with basic DIY skills. Here are some key points to consider during the installation process.

Easy installation process

Most backup batteries for garage door openers are designed for easy installation and can be completed within a few hours. The process usually involves connecting the battery to the opener’s power terminals and securing it in place.

How to install a backup battery for your garage door opener

  1. Identify the power terminals on the garage door opener.
  2. Disconnect the power supply to the opener.
  3. Connect the backup battery to the power terminals on the opener.
  4. Secure the backup battery in place using the provided hardware.
  5. Reconnect the power supply to the opener.
  6. Test the backup battery to ensure it’s functioning properly.

It’s important to follow the manufacturer’s guidelines during the installation process to ensure proper installation and avoid damaging the garage door opener or the battery.
